Logistics Specialists receive parts, maintain inventory, transfer and return parts as needed for Technicians in multiple data centers. This role manages the storage, and ensures a safe and neat workplace . Duties include but not limited to:


-Receiving, stowing and picking, packaging and shipping, sorting and counting of computer hardware parts physically and logically.

-Working on part request from Technicians and reviewing inventory availability.

-Monitor Logistics dashboards and request for actions to ensure that the InfraOps meet the KPI target.

-Balance the inventory within the cluster and region when needed

-Coordinate with procurement and vendor to schedule part delivery. Track and update shipment status and manage the delivery issues with transportation vendors

-Storage facility management and administration. Cycle count, daily audit, 7S etc.

-Complying with inventory process in part handling activities for instance parts quarantine, media parts, critical parts control.

-Participation in continuous improvement initiatives in addition to day-to-day inventory requests.

-Process RMA to vendors and scrap parts
